The Art of Sourdough: Bread Head's Signature Offering
Bread Head's sourdough has become legendary in Manhattan Beach, drawing bread enthusiasts from across Los Angeles County. The bakery's signature sourdough uses a starter that's been cultivated for years, creating a depth of flavor that commercial breads simply cannot replicate.
The sourdough process at Bread Head involves a meticulous 24-36 hour fermentation period, during which wild yeasts and beneficial bacteria transform simple ingredients—flour, water, and salt—into something extraordinary. The result is a loaf with a perfectly crisp crust, chewy interior, and that distinctive tangy flavor that sourdough lovers crave.

The Science of Perfect Bread: Techniques That Set Bread Head Apart
What makes Bread Head's bread consistently excellent? It's a combination of scientific understanding and artisanal skill. The bakers at Bread Head have mastered the delicate balance of hydration, temperature, and timing that determines bread quality.
They use high-hydration doughs that create an open, airy crumb structure and employ techniques like autolyse (a rest period that allows flour to fully hydrate) and stretch-and-fold (a gentle kneading method that develops gluten without overworking the dough). These methods require more time and attention but produce bread with superior texture and flavor.
